The surgical treatment of lower extremities deformities in osteogenesis imperfecta (OI) remains a challenge despite recent improvements in the medical treatment, the development of new surgical tools, and a team approach including postoperative rehabilitation. Preoperative assessment is crucial to appreciate the soft-tissue tension and evaluate bone deformities and the size of the medullary canal. Osteotomies and intramedullary (IM) rodding is the solution of choice to support fragile bones, while plates create a stress-raiser effect and should not be used. The choice of IM rods remains controversial. While regular IM devices (e.g., Rush rods, Kirschner wires, and elastic nails) are easy to use and readily available, they are rapidly outgrown and lead to multiple interventions during skeletal growth. The telescopic (or growing) rods (such as Dubow-Bailey, Sheffield, and Fassier-Duval) are not always available, more expensive, and more difficult to use. However, the reoperation rate with these devices is generally lower than with more conventional devices. Parents and caregivers must remember though that despite these advances in the management, several surgical interventions will likely be necessary during growth.
